Adds a Skill and Claude Code plugin that installs semantic anchor context into coding agents (Claude Code, Codex, Gemini CLI, Copilot, Cursor) at session start, plus a translator skill for recognising established methodologies in prompts.

What is included

Plugin infrastructure (plugins/semantic-anchors/)

  • plugin.json, tile.json: plugin manifest and marketplace tile (Claude only)
  • hooks/hooks.json + scripts/prompt-onboarding.sh: SessionStart hook that fires once per 24 h when no semantic-anchor block is present, prompting the user to run onboarding. Cooldown and project state tracked in ~/.claude/semantic-anchor-onboarding/state.json. Hardened against malformed state files (JSONDecodeError, ValueError on fromisoformat).
  • .claude-plugin/marketplace.json: marketplace registration

Semantic anchor onboarding skill (skill/semantic-anchor-onboarding/) 6-step workflow for installing a small, stable set of semantic anchors into AGENTS.md / CLAUDE.md / GEMINI.md / copilot-instructions.md:

  1. Decide scope (project vs. home directory)
  2. Select anchors — conflict groups, always-on defaults, task-local list
  3. Render the anchor block from assets/templates/anchor-block.md
  4. Run scripts/install.sh (idempotent marker-based injection, pure sh)
  5. Add native agent behaviour (Claude hook, Gemini mirror, Copilot instructions)
  6. Validate on a fresh session

Supports: Claude Code, Codex/OpenAI, Gemini CLI, GitHub Copilot, Cursor. Platform: Unix/macOS and Windows (Git Bash). No dependencies beyond sh and python3 (already required for JSON manipulation in hooks).

  • scripts/install.sh: injects/replaces the anchor block in the best available markdown file; installs a Claude SessionStart hook when --claude-hook is passed; backs up settings.json with plain cp before overwriting
  • references/anchor-selection.md: category guide, conflict groups, safe always-on defaults, task-local list
  • references/agent-support.md: per-agent loading rules and portability notes
  • assets/templates/: starter templates for AGENTS.md, CLAUDE.md, GEMINI.md, copilot-instructions.md, anchor-block.md

Semantic anchor translator skill (skill/semantic-anchor-translator/) Updated catalog.md with:

  • New entries: ATAM, LASR by Toth/Zörner, OWASP Top 10 (were referenced but undefined)
  • Missing Proponents added: Testing Pyramid (Mike Cohn), Property-Based Testing (Claessen/Hughes), Clean Architecture (Robert C. Martin), Hexagonal Architecture (Alistair Cockburn)
  • Missing Also-known-as added: Clean Architecture, Hexagonal Architecture

Pre-commit sync hook (.githooks/pre-commit)

Overwrites plugins/semantic-anchors/skills/ from skill/ on every commit so the two never diverge. Pure sh — no extra dependencies, works on Unix/macOS and Windows Git Bash. Activate once after cloning:
git config core.hooksPath .githooks

scripts/sync-claude-plugin.sh changed from bash to POSIX sh (set -eu, no pipefail). plugins/semantic-anchors/skills/README.md added with do-not-edit notice. CLAUDE.md updated with first-time setup instruction.

⚠️ Potential issue | 🟠 Major

Ein unvollständiger Markerblock kann den Rest der Datei abschneiden.

Line 142 prüft nur den Startmarker. Wenn der Endmarker fehlt, bleibt in_block ab Line 149 bis EOF aktiv und alles danach wird beim Rewrite verworfen. Vor dem Ersetzen sollte die Datei mindestens auf ein vollständiges, geordnetes Marker-Paar geprüft werden.
